<pedantic>Technically, it is a unique number assigned to a browser. This could be a window too, not necessarily a tab.</pedantic> You'll see the numbers show up in the "Windows" menu too. I think this indicator originally pre-dated the existence of browser tabs, where it was used exclusively to number the open browser windows.

Have no issues on my Towered 060/BPPC with mediator and 100Mb NIC either.

The problem seems to stem from G-REX setup

To find your 060 revision. Either use “WhichAmiga” or Amitestkit

The blank pages are around Rev 1 to rev 5 060 CPUs, but is fixed if you use THORsMMULibs install which fixes the 060 bug. Rev 6 is NOT effected
